River Wye Booksellers is a Grade II listed building in the Brecon Beacons National Park local planning authority area, Wales. First listed on 1 February 1988. Bookstore.

Description

River Wye Booksellers is a 17th-century timber-framed building that was originally jettied and has undergone later alterations. It consists of a pair of two-storey, gable-ended ranges, with an additional range attached to the rear that runs parallel to the street. The building features slate roofs and brick chimney stacks.

No 13 has broad eaves, exposed studding on the front gable, and a carved timber bracket at the right corner. The main posts thicken significantly below the tie beam. There is a blocked timber mullioned attic window above a heightened first-floor casement window. The shop front is modern, with small pane glazing, built out under the jetty and curving around the corner, featuring double doors and a rubble plinth. There is a small pane casement window on the right end above the return of the shop front, and an advanced rendered stone gable end with a chimney breast beyond.

No 14 has a roughcast front with a first-floor sash window that includes marginal glazing bars, flanked by plate glass shop windows on either side of the central entrance. The roughcast left side also features a similar shop window.

Inside No 13, the levels vary, and there are plain beams. The ground floor of No 14 is open to the rear, showcasing chamfered main beams and simple pegged trusses with double collars.
